Centos安装mariaDB方法


1、安装mariadb-server

yum install mariadb-server

2、安装相关环境

yum install mariadb-embedded mariadb-libs mariadb-bench mariadb mariadb-sever

3、安装mariadb

yum install mariadb

4、启动mariadb

systemctl start mariadb

5、设置开机启动

systemctl enable mariadb

6、配置数据库(主要是设置密码)

mysql_secure_installation

7、设置编码

①在/etc/my.cnf文件下添加如下内容:

init_connect='SET collation_connection = utf8_unicode_ci'init_connect='SET NAMES utf8'character-set-server=utf8collation-server=utf8_unicode_ciskip-character-set-client-handshake

②在/etc/my.cnf.d/client.cnf文件[client]标签下添加如下内容:

default-character-set=utf8

③在/etc/my.cnf.d/mysql-clients.cnf文件[mysql]标签下添加如下内容:

default-character-set=utf8

④重启mariadb,命令如下:

systemctl restart mariadb

⑤查看mariadb查看字符集,语句如下:

show variables like "%character%";show variables like "%collation%";

8、允许远程连接mariadb数据库

①关闭防火墙,命令如下:

systemctl stop firewalld

②修改user表中host,具体如下**(依次执行即可):**

select host, user from user;update user set host='%' where host='centos.portal';flush privileges;systemctl restart mariadb